Welcome to Oklahoma
Oklahoma is where the Midwest, South, and Southwest converge. That blending of cultures offers balance and many lovely surprises! With an exceptional art scene, eclectic districts with local flare, and an outdoor recreation renaissance centered around the city core, Oklahoma City's 1.4 million metropolitan residents are among the most satisfied in the nation.

Resident led tax initiatives have catalyzed new development, improved infrastructure, increased quality of life, and boosted business by $7 billion and counting. Low cost of living, short commutes, and a diversified economy beckon new residents, including Millennials, who rank it among the top three places to live.

Equidistant from both coasts and located at the crossroads of three major interstate highways, Oklahoma City ensures smooth travel and transportation to anywhere in the U.S. Just ninety minutes to Tulsa and three from Dallas, we are also within an easy drive to Wichita, Kansas City, and Little Rock. The Heartland Flyer Amtrak train provides twice-daily service to Fort Worth, while three airports host 150 flights from 21 non-stop destinations to supply commercial, corporate and leisure travel needs.

SSM Health’s healing legacy originated in St. Louis, Missouri over 150 years ago where five nuns, known as the Sisters of St. Mary’s, were called to aid and heal in God’s name. Since those humble beginnings, SSM Health has grown to become one of the largest Catholic not-for-profit integrated health systems serving the Midwest. Today, our healing ministry includes over 13,900 providers and approximately 40,000 team members, all working together with a shared Mission to deliver exceptional health care services that reveal the healing presence of God across Missouri, Oklahoma, Illinois, and Wisconsin.

With 23 hospitals, 12 post-acute care centers, and over 650 physician offices and specialty care clinics spread across four states, SSM Health offers a world of opportunities where clinicians can do a world of good.
